Menu
© 2026 The Couch Critic
Status
Released
Release
2022
Runtime
5m
"Walking on eggshells..."
A short film about domestic abuse (coercive control, gaslighting, domestic violence).
4 Cast Members
Cia Allan
Elizabeth
Allan Richardson
David
Heather White
Young Elizabeth
Lewis Healey
Young David